Over time, elevated stress hormones suppress the immune system, making the animal more susceptible to infections. Stress also delays wound healing, exacerbates gastrointestinal issues (like stress colitis), and worsens cardiovascular conditions.
Animal behavior and veterinary science are two sides of the same coin. A veterinarian cannot fully treat the physical body without addressing the emotional state, just as a behavior professional cannot modify a behavior without understanding the animal's underlying physiology.
